    You know that feeling when your lineup looks upgraded on paper, then Ranked Seasons exposes the weak spot in three innings? That’s the July 13 problem in MLB The Show 26. Spotlight Drop 1 is pushing 95-plus cards into regular squads, but chasing every shiny pull can drain your Stubs before the next program even starts. Rocchio is the obvious target, and a careful stash of MLB 26 stubs helps when the market swings. Don’t confuse a higher overall rating with a complete roster. You still need defense, speed, and enough lineup pop to survive late innings.

    Start With The July Drop

    Spotlight Drop 1 arrived on July 13, 2026, with Brayan Rocchio at 97 OVR. He brings the kind of shortstop defense, contact, and speed that actually changes how you build the infield. Joshua Kuroda-Grauer and Sean Keys headline the Topps Now additions, and every card in this release sits at 95 OVR or higher. That marks the Red Diamond phase, so don’t burn every pack the moment it appears. Check the card’s price, compare it with your current starter, and sell duplicates unless they serve a collection or lineup need. Keep working active July programs and Team Affinity updates before spending on marginal upgrades.

    Rocchio Punishes Lazy Lineups

    The intended move is simple: add Rocchio at shortstop or second base, take the chemistry boost, and surround him with recent power bats. The common mistake is forcing him into the lineup without checking defensive alignment, then wasting daily mission progress on a roster that can’t finish the needed stats. Other players read three old guides, assume the best offline path hasn’t changed, and ignore the WBC-themed events still available for parallel XP and collection progress. Run the content in this order instead.

    1. Claim active July program and Team Affinity rewards before opening Spotlight Packs.
    2. Use Rocchio at shortstop first, then test second base if your chemistry setup gains more there.
    3. Play the WBC event when you need parallel XP, program progress, or collection pieces.
    4. Move to Conquest and Mini Seasons for offline grinding, taking strongholds with your upgraded squad.
    5. Finish daily missions before logging off, then sell duplicate Spotlight cards rather than stacking dead inventory.

    Choose Speed Or Volume

    There are two sensible routes through this drop. The fast route buys or pulls the exact upgrades you need, then heads straight into Ranked Seasons with Rocchio and power support. It saves time, but it costs Stubs and leaves less room for the next major release. The patient route clears programs, Team Affinity tasks, WBC events, Conquest, and Mini Seasons first. It takes more games, yet it builds parallel progress and collections while giving free packs a chance to fill the gaps. If your shortstop is already strong, take the patient route. If defense is costing you games every night, Rocchio deserves the immediate slot.

    Answer The Questions That Matter

    Is Rocchio worth chasing at 97 OVR? Yes, especially if your middle infield lacks range and speed. Should you open every Spotlight Pack? No-open enough to complete your target, then sell duplicates and protect your currency. Start by claiming the July rewards, slotting Rocchio where chemistry improves, and clearing daily missions.
